A major fire swept through a biscuit factory in Trikala, Greece, destroying the production facility and leaving workers facing job losses.

The fire erupted at the industrial plant as the sun set, sending a large plume of black smoke over the city. Emergency responders arrived to find the blaze had already reached the main production hall, where industrial ovens and machinery fueled the flames.

Emergency Response Mobilized

Firefighters established a defensive perimeter around the facility to prevent the fire from spreading to neighboring businesses and residential areas. The intense heat warped the building’s structural supports, forcing crews to shift their focus from saving the structure to containing the blaze.

As the night progressed, portions of the roof began collapsing. Firefighters worked to manage water supplies and navigate the volatile environment, avoiding the risk of secondary explosions or structural failures.

Morning Aftermath

By dawn, the fire had diminished significantly, leaving behind a charred shell of the once-operational factory. The facility, which had been a major employer in Trikala, was rendered unusable.

Local authorities have begun investigating the cause of the fire. Workers and residents now face uncertainty about employment and the community’s economic stability in the weeks ahead.
